Tony Martinez is the President and Chief Executive Officer for Renaissance Global Services, LLC, a project and construction management consulting firm focused on the pharmaceutical, infrastructure, and healthcare fields in the private and public sectors.
Tony is a proven leader with over twenty-five years of experience in leading multi-disciplinary, multi-cultural teams and conducting program/project management of multi-million-dollar projects in a wide variety of sectors. He has over twenty years of experience in managing municipal capital improvement projects and commercial and residential land development projects from inception through design and construction. He develops solutions to complex problems and transforms strategic visions into actionable plans complemented by firsthand knowledge and technical expertise. He has also conducted change management and process improvement for acquisition and delivery of data and applications in the banking sector. His experience includes multiple overseas assignments and extensive collaboration with private and government entities.
Tony holds a Bachelor’s Degree and a Master’s Degree in Civil Engineering from the New Jersey Institute of Technology and earned a Master’s Degree in Inter-American Defense and Security from Inter-American Defense College.

Tony has more than thirty years of service in the US Army. He is
currently a Colonel in the Army Reserve and the Commander of the 3rd Brigade, 98th Training Division responsible for supporting Army Basic Training at Fort Jackson, SC and Fort Benning, GA. He also served in
Iraq and Afghanistan and commanded an Airborne Civil Affairs Battalion.

ANNUAL SCHOLARSHIP PROGRAMA vital part of the program is the concept of providing our Veterans a platform to engage with our younger generation and showing them the value of service to our country and each other.
The Scholarship provides funds to an individual within a Veteran family who is enrolled in a ROTC program while attending a High School or Higher Education Institution in the United States.

Cadet Command Sergeant Major Hallie Laber currently serves as the Cadet Command Sergeant Major for the Falcon Army JROTC Battalion at North Country Union High School in Newport, VT.
Cadet Laber is a homeschooled student from Irasburg, VT. She is heavily involved with her church, community, and Army JROTC Battalion. She volunteers as a Teen Group Leader for over 12 students from ages 13 to 15 in Irasburg, VT. Hallie also works for Northern Precision Foam in Irasburg, VT, specializing in construction, demolition and foaming. She is also an avid outdoorsman. Hallie is also a White Belt in Jiu jitsu. Cadet Laber plans on attending Norwich University in the fall of 2023.
